Scène de jeu (échec ?) entre khmers Galerie sud du Bayon (Angkor) _________________ Le Bayon est le temple-montagne du roi khmer : Jayavarman VII (1181-1218), le vainqueur des Chams et le plus grand constructeur des rois khmers. La construction du Bayon a commencé vers 1195. Ce temple est célèbre pour ses 54 tours décorées par 4 visages. Comme temple d'Etat, il était au centre d'Angkor Thom, la capitale du royaume. C'est un temple "œcuménique " qui associe l'hindouisme (les dieux Shiva et Vishnu y sont largement présents) et le bouddhisme car le Roi était lui-même bouddhiste du grand véhicule : Mahâyâna. Le Roi et la famille royale étaient représentés dans le Bayon sous forme de bouddhas dans les chapelles entourant la grande tour centrale. |
